Netanyahu rallies around Viktor Orbán at ’far-right conference’

Summary by The New Arab
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u made a virtual appearance at a "far-right conference" in Budapest last weekend, designed to boost his key European ally, Hungarian Prime Minister Viktor Orbán, as he slumbers into next month's general election.
